Meadowlake Golf & Swim Club
Played On 05/20/2014Ok for $5, otherwise not worth money
I could have caught the course at a bad time, but we had a hard time distinguishing rough from fairway. It's unfortunate as this course could be magnificent if it was kept! The fairway was like hitting out of your salad bowl. Greens were like putting on thick carpet. On the bright side the greens were accepting and easy to stop your ball on. If you hit the rough you might as well take a drop, as you would not find your ball! Won't return, if you pay more than $5, you won't be satisfied.
